School Calendar (2007-08)

Click here for  2008-09 Calendar

This is the district calendar. Check with individual schools for their additional events.

Schools open Aug. 21.
Winter break – Dec. 24-Jan. 4.
Spring break – March 31-April 4.
Last day of school – June 3.
